Recent malware campaigns have been identified utilizing innovative techniques for delivery and execution. Notable threats include the use of JSON storage services for malware delivery and the resurgence of Gootloader, which is spreading malicious payloads through compromised infrastructure. These attacks are impacting various sectors, including defense and software development environments.
